网页制作伪类(给网页创建了链接伪类后,能给页面带来什么效果)

金生 网页制作 2025-07-10 35 0

css伪元素和伪类的区别

1、CSS伪类是基于元素的当前状态选择元素,而伪元素则是用于创建HTML文档结构之外的虚拟元素。它们之间的区别主要体现在以下几个方面: 定义与用途: 伪类:是基于元素的特定状态来应用样式的选择器。例如,:hover 用于鼠标悬停状态,:focus 用于元素获得焦点时。它们反映了元素的行为或状态。

2、CSS伪类和伪元素的区别及相关应用如下:区别 伪类:用途:用于选择处于特定状态的元素,如悬停、聚焦、活动状态等。功能:为特定情境下的元素提供特定的样式渲染。示例:a:hover,当用户鼠标悬停在链接上时应用样式。

3、伪类和伪元素:在CSS的优先级计算中,伪类和伪元素与普通的元素选择器具有相同的优先级。不过,由于伪元素创造了一个新的虚拟元素,因此它们应用的样式不会继承到原始元素上,而是应用于这个新创建的虚拟元素上。

4、伪类和伪元素的区别在于它们的功能和使用场景。伪类是CSS3引入的概念,用于选择DOM树外的信息或常规CSS选择器无法获取的信息。伪类主要有两种功能:一是用于格式化DOM树以外的信息,如超链接的:link和:visited状态;二是用于获取DOM树中无法直接访问的信息,例如:first-child选择器。

5、与伪类针对特定状态元素不同,伪元素用于操作元素内部的具体内容,如第一个字符或第一行等。伪元素的层次比伪类更深,因此其动态性相对较低。设计伪元素的目的在于实现普通选择器无法完成的选择和操作,例如选取元素内容的首字、首行,或者在某些内容前面添加装饰等。

伪类和伪元素是什么

伪类和伪元素是CSS(层叠样式表)中用于选择和格式化文档中特定部分的扩展。伪类:定义:伪类用于选择处于特定状态或条件的元素。它们允许开发者为元素在特定状态下应用不同的样式。常见伪类:hover:当鼠标悬停在元素上时触发,常用于改变链接或按钮的样式。

伪类和伪元素是CSS中的特殊元素,浏览器能够自动识别。伪类用于区分不同类型的元素,比如已访问链接和可激活链接,描述了锚点的不同状态。伪元素则指代特定部分的元素,比如段落的第一个字母。伪元素和伪类规则的形式为:选择符:伪类 { 属性: 值 } 或 选择符:伪元素 { 属性: 值 }。

CSS伪类是基于元素的当前状态来选择元素,而伪元素则是用于创建在html文档结构之外的虚拟元素。它们之间的区别主要体现在以下几个方面: 定义与用途: 伪类:是基于元素的特定状态来应用样式的选择器。例如,:hover 用于鼠标悬停状态,:focus 用于元素获得焦点时。它们反映了元素的行为或状态。

css伪类、伪元素是什么?有什么区别?

CSS伪类是基于元素的当前状态来选择元素,而伪元素则是用于创建在HTML文档结构之外的虚拟元素。它们之间的区别主要体现在以下几个方面: 定义与用途: 伪类:是基于元素的特定状态来应用样式的选择器。例如,:hover 用于鼠标悬停状态,:focus 用于元素获得焦点时。它们反映了元素的行为或状态。

区别 伪类:用途:用于选择处于特定状态的元素,如悬停、聚焦、活动状态等。功能:为特定情境下的元素提供特定的样式渲染。示例:a:hover,当用户鼠标悬停在链接上时应用样式。伪元素:用途:用于选择元素的特定部分,如元素的开始或结束标记,元素的子元素之前或之后的区域等。

伪类和伪元素是CSS中的特殊元素,浏览器能够自动识别。伪类用于区分不同类型的元素,比如已访问链接和可激活链接,描述了锚点的不同状态。伪元素则指代特定部分的元素,比如段落的第一个字母。伪元素和伪类规则的形式为:选择符:伪类 { 属性: 值 } 或 选择符:伪元素 { 属性: 值 }。

伪元素则是指那些在逻辑上存在的元素,但并不实际存在于文档树中的特定部分。它们代表了某个元素内部的某个子元素,尽管这些子元素在逻辑上是存在的,但它们并没有实际存在于文档树中,因此被称为伪元素。伪类选择元素是基于当前元素的状态或特性,而非静态的id、class或属性。

css伪类和伪元素的主要区别如下: 是否创造新元素:伪类:不创造新的元素,它们只是对现有元素的一种抽象表示,用于选择元素的特定状态或位置。例如,:hover伪类用于选择鼠标悬停状态的元素,:first-child伪类用于选择其父元素的第一个子元素。伪元素:创造了一个新的虚拟元素,并将其插入到文档树中。

伪类和伪元素的区别在于它们的功能和使用场景。伪类是CSS3引入的概念,用于选择DOM树外的信息或常规CSS选择器无法获取的信息。伪类主要有两种功能:一是用于格式化DOM树以外的信息,如超链接的:link和:visited状态;二是用于获取DOM树中无法直接访问的信息,例如:first-child选择器。

什么是伪元素、伪类、伪对象?

1、伪类和伪元素是CSS中的特殊元素,浏览器能够自动识别。伪类用于区分不同类型的元素,比如已访问链接和可激活链接,描述了锚点的不同状态。伪元素则指代特定部分的元素,比如段落的第一个字母。伪元素和伪类规则的形式为:选择符:伪类 { 属性: 值 } 或 选择符:伪元素 { 属性: 值 }。

2、定义与用途: 伪类:是基于元素的特定状态来应用样式的选择器。例如,:hover 用于鼠标悬停状态,:focus 用于元素获得焦点时。它们反映了元素的行为或状态。 伪元素:用于在文档中插入一些不存在于HTML中的虚拟元素,并对其应用样式。例如,:before 和 :after 可以在元素内容的前后插入新的内容或装饰。

网页制作伪类(给网页创建了链接伪类后,能给页面带来什么效果)

3、伪类和伪元素是CSS(层叠样式表)中用于选择和格式化文档中特定部分的扩展。伪类:定义:伪类用于选择处于特定状态或条件的元素。它们允许开发者为元素在特定状态下应用不同的样式。常见伪类:hover:当鼠标悬停在元素上时触发,常用于改变链接或按钮的样式。

4、伪元素则是指那些在逻辑上存在的元素,但并不实际存在于文档树中的特定部分。它们代表了某个元素内部的某个子元素,尽管这些子元素在逻辑上是存在的,但它们并没有实际存在于文档树中,因此被称为伪元素。伪类选择元素是基于当前元素的状态或特性,而非静态的id、class或属性。

伪类注意

1、使用伪类时需要注意以下几点:用户期待与颜色选择:使用伪类为已访问过的链接添加不同颜色是个良好的实践,因为许多用户对此有所期待。随着CSS技术发展,传统的蓝色紫色链接颜色组合可能不再适用,设计时需要考虑更多元的色彩选择。

2、在使用CSS伪类时,要确保选择器的正确性和样式的合理性,避免产生样式冲突或无效样式。同时,要注意浏览器的兼容性问题,确保在不同的浏览器中都能正确显示和应用样式。综上所述,CSS超链接伪类是用于设置超链接不同状态样式的有效工具,必须按照固定的顺序书写才能确保样式的正确应用。

3、值得注意的是,伪类和伪元素的使用应当遵循W3C的标准,以确保代码的兼容性和可维护性。同时,合理利用伪类和伪元素,可以使网页设计更加灵活和高效,提升用户体验。最后,虽然伪类和伪元素在很多方面有相似之处,但它们的功能和应用场景各有侧重。

css中什么是伪类和伪元素?

CSS伪类是基于元素的当前状态来选择元素,而伪元素则是用于创建在HTML文档结构之外的虚拟元素。它们之间的区别主要体现在以下几个方面: 定义与用途: 伪类:是基于元素的特定状态来应用样式的选择器。例如,:hover 用于鼠标悬停状态,:focus 用于元素获得焦点时。它们反映了元素的行为或状态。

在CSS中,伪类最初仅用于表示元素的动态状态,例如链接的不同状态(LVHA)。CSS2标准的扩展使伪类的概念超越了这一点,成为了一种逻辑存在但在文档树中无需明确标识的分类。伪元素则是指那些在逻辑上存在的元素,但并不实际存在于文档树中的特定部分。

伪类:不创造新的元素,它们只是对现有元素的一种抽象表示,用于选择元素的特定状态或位置。例如,:hover伪类用于选择鼠标悬停状态的元素,:first-child伪类用于选择其父元素的第一个子元素。伪元素:创造了一个新的虚拟元素,并将其插入到文档树中。这个新元素不存在于DOM中,但可以对其添加内容和样式。